Physical Description:
Average frame. On the thin side, but has added strength as he
has matured.
Mechanics: Throws from a
low three-quarters arm slot. Starts on the third base side.
Loose, athletic delivery. Short arm action. Hides the ball well.
Crouches before coming forward. Some effort in his delivery, but
repeats it well. Noticeable head whack.
Fastball:
89-92 mph. Tops out at 94 mph. Pitch shows sink. Velocity
slightly ticked up in 2024, but not much. Reportedly has again
in Spring Training 2025. Advanced feel for
command and control for his age. Pounds the zone and already
shows the ability to locate. Struggles to miss bats, more
something he throws to generate weak contact on the ground.
Velocity increased in 2022 from 84-86 mph to the 89-91 range,
giving hope of continued steady increases as he continued
maturing, but has only had modest velocity gains since.
Potential fringe-average offering.
Cutter:
86-88 mph. Short, horizontal break. Did not throw often in
outing scouted in 2024. Was primarily used as a change-of-pace
pitch. Fringe-average potential.
Changeup:
84-86 mph. Advanced feel and confidence. Throws with deceptive
arm speed. Shows promising bat-missing ability and is already
missing bats in the low minors. Pitch shows late dive down and
in on right-handed hitters and away from left-handed hitters.
Shows confidence and feel in the pitch and is willing to throw
it in any count to any hitter. Can pull the string on it and
take something off when looking for a swinging strike.
Especially effective against left-handed hitters. Potential
above-average offering.

Slider: 80-83 mph. Long, horizontal shape.
Advanced feel for spin with a high spin rate. Willing to use it
in any count. Very useful as a chase pitch, generating plenty of
whiffs. Potential solid-average offering.
Curveball: 76-79 mph. Pitch shows depth and tight
rotation. Solid feel and will use in any count. Has shown the
ability to bury it down-and-away when looking for a whiff or
land it in the zone. Potential average offering.
Career Notes: Red Sox 2021 Latin Program Pitcher of the
Year. Participated in the Fall Performance Program in 2021. Was
set to participate in the 2022 Fall Performance Program that was
canceled due to Hurricane Ian. Named to 2025 Spring Breakout
roster.
Summation:
Potential emergency up-and-down depth starter. Ceiling of a
back-end starter. Fastball is on the light side and is his
third-most-used pitch, but has a strong command-and-control
profile and advanced secondary offerings. Shows particular feel
for his changeup and slider and the ability to command them in
and out of the strike zone. Also does a good job repeating his
delivery and locating his fastball in the zone, but struggles to
miss bats with it. Fastball being on the light side tempers
future projection, but stands out in models due to his ability
to miss bats with his changeup and slider and strike-throwing
ability.
